Maduro: Economic recovery requires the effort of all workers

The President of the Republic, Nicolás Maduro, stressed that the economic recovery of the country requires the contribution of all workers:

“I ask the Venezuelan working class to think about the labor rights linked to the sustainable fiscal and tributary balance. Work is the center of the effort of economic recovery so that everyone has a salary that allows them to live”, wrote the head of state on the Twitter social network.

In another message, the President added that “The will of the Venezuelan people is unbreakable, there are no obstacles that can impede progress and overcoming difficulties”, in turn, he added that a sample of this is musician Juvel Campos, who appears in a video showing his talent despite having a disability.

He proposed that the Venezuelan working class should promote labor rights that are linked to sustainable fiscal and tax equilibrium.

The Economic Recovery, Growth and Prosperity Plan designed by the Executive includes the monetary reconversion, which has a new currency denominated Sovereign Bolívar, a new gasoline subsidy policy and the establishment of a single exchange rate, which will fluctuate in accordance to the auctions of the System of Exchange Rates of Floating Market Supplementary Exchange Rate (DICOM).

Since last Monday is circulating the new monetary cone, the Sovereign Bolivar (Bs S), which will be anchored to Petro, whose value will be Bs S 3,600. In that sense, the National Government set the minimum salary at Bs S 1,800, that is, half Petro.
